Trace the stories of Paris’s most celebrated figures on a private 2-hour guided walk through Pere Lachaise Cemetery.

Graves of legends: Visit the tombs of Edith Piaf, Oscar Wilde, Jim Morrison, Frédéric Chopin, Molière, La Fontaine, and Modigliani, each accompanied by stories of their lives and legacies.

Historical insights: Learn about the cemetery’s unique features, from its 19th-century origins to its role in Parisian history, with detailed commentary from your guide.
